Daily Habits That Preserve Your Floors' Beauty


A massive part of wood flooring treatment is uniformity. Daily activities such as walking with wet shoes or dragging furnishings can quicken damage. It's remarkable how much of a difference small changes can make. Something as straightforward as leaving footwear at the door or sweeping with a soft broom every evening can extend the life of your flooring's coating.


It's likewise essential to manage moisture carefully. Timber and water have a challenging relationship. A wet wipe could look like the ideal tool, yet too much water can seep right into seams and trigger swelling or contorting in time. A slightly moist microfiber mop is a better option-- and if you're in an area like San Jose, where seaside air can be humid, maintaining moisture degrees consistent inside is just as necessary.


Seasonal Changes and How to Handle Them


Seasonal shifts often indicate changes in humidity and temperature, which hardwood floorings react to more than the majority of recognize. You may observe your floor covering expanding slightly in the summer and having in the wintertime. These fluctuations are normal, but if they're also severe, gaps or buckling can happen.


Setting up a humidifier in the wintertime or utilizing a dehumidifier throughout the summertime assists support the interior climate. This is especially useful after a hardwood floor installation in Santa Clara, where you intend to shield your investment from early ecological stress and anxiety.


Dealing with Scratches and Dullness the Right Way


With time, minor scratches and scuffs are inevitable. The key is to address them before they grow or accumulate. If you have pet dogs or frequently rearrange furniture, you'll see even more indicators of surface area wear. Really felt pads under furnishings legs can stop much of these issues, but what concerning the marks that already exist?


Light scratches can frequently be buffed out with a touch-up pen or timber fixing kit. For dullness, making use of a floor polish that's compatible with your surface can restore a few of the initial luster. Just ensure you're using items created specifically for Hardwood flooring in San Jose, as making use of the wrong cleaner can do even more damage than good.


Long-Term Maintenance: When and How to Refinish


Every floor gets to a point where basic cleaning no more revitalizes its look. That's where refinishing comes in. This process entails fining sand down the surface to get rid of old finishes and then using a new safety layer. Depending upon the wear and type of wood, floors can generally be refinished every 7 to 10 years.


If you've lately had hardwood floor installation in Santa Clara, you likely won't require this for some time-- however it's good to plan ahead. Watch on locations with high website traffic. If the finish has worn away to the bare wood, it's time to think about a specialist refinish. Not only does this bring back the visual, but it likewise shields the timber from lasting damage.
